To understand how sound frequencies influence the brain, it’s essential to grasp the concept of sound waves. Sound is fundamentally a vibration that travels through different mediums, and it is characterized by its frequency, measured in hertz (Hz). The frequency of a sound wave dictates its pitch; higher frequencies correspond to higher pitches and vice versa. Humans can hear sounds ranging from approximately 20 Hz to 20,000 Hz. However, it’s not the range of human hearing that is critical to understanding The Brain Song™ but rather the specific frequencies utilized and their effects on brain activity.

Research has illuminated the connection between sound frequencies and brainwave patterns. The human brain operates at different frequencies depending on the state of consciousness—these are defined as delta (0.5-4 Hz), theta (4-8 Hz), alpha (8-12 Hz), beta (12-30 Hz), and gamma (30 Hz and above). Each brainwave state correlates with specific mental states such as deep sleep, relaxation, wakefulness, and intense concentration.     Why Cravings Happen and How to Manage Them

    Cravings are a common experience for many people, often arising unexpectedly and sometimes leading to unhealthy choices. Understanding why these cravings occur can help individuals find effective strategies to manage them. Various factors contribute to cravings, including biological, psychological, and environmental influences.

    From a biological perspective, cravings can be linked to the body’s need for certain nutrients or energy. When you are deprived of specific nutrients, your body may signal you to seek out foods that contain them. For example, if you are lacking in iron, you might crave red meat or leafy greens. Likewise, if you’ve been skipping meals, your blood sugar levels can drop, leading to sudden and intense cravings for high-sugar or high-carbohydrate foods that can quickly elevate your energy levels.

    Psychological factors also play a significant role in cravings. Emotional states such as stress, anxiety, or even boredom can trigger a desire for comfort foods, often high in sugar or fat. This connection between mood and food can create a cycle where individuals eat in response to their emotions, leading to unhealthy eating patterns and weight gain. Over time, this can make cravings feel even more uncontrollable, as they may become linked to coping mechanisms for stress or negative emotions.

    Environmental factors, such as the presence of tempting foods in your surroundings, can also stimulate cravings. For instance, seeing advertisements for fast food or being around others who are eating certain foods can trigger your desire for those items. The accessibility of snacks and processed foods in your home can impact your likelihood to indulge in cravings, especially during times of stress or fatigue.

    Managing cravings effectively often requires a multi-faceted approach that addresses these biological, psychological, and environmental influences. Here are some strategies to consider:

    1. **Balanced Nutrition**: Ensure that your diet is well-balanced and includes a variety of nutrients. Eating regular meals with adequate protein, healthy fats, and fiber can help keep your blood sugar stable, reducing the likelihood of cravings. If you often find yourself craving certain foods, it might be helpful to incorporate healthier alternatives into your meals. For instance, if you crave sweets, consider fruits or dark chocolate as satisfying yet natural options.

    2. **Mindfulness Practices**: Learn to recognize when cravings arise and understand their triggers. Mindfulness techniques, such as meditation or journaling, can help you acknowledge your cravings without judgment. This awareness can allow you to respond to cravings more thoughtfully, rather than impulsively giving in.

    3. **Stay Hydrated**: Sometimes, cravings can be confused with hunger or emotional needs. Hydration is crucial; feeling thirsty can often be misinterpreted as hunger. Make sure to drink enough water throughout the day, which can help reduce unnecessary cravings.

    4. **Healthy Snacking**: When cravings strike, having healthy snacks on hand can make a significant difference. Nuts, yogurt, or cut-up vegetables can provide a satisfying crunch or sweetness while keeping your nutrition in check.

    5. **Limit Exposure**: If certain foods trigger your cravings, try to limit your exposure to them. Keeping tempting snacks out of your home or workspace can reduce the frequency and intensity of cravings.

    6. **Seek Support**: Sometimes, sharing your goals with friends, family, or a support group can be beneficial. They can encourage you to make healthier choices and help hold you accountable.

    In conclusion, cravings are a natural part of human behavior driven by a mix of biological, psychological, and environmental factors. Learning to manage these cravings effectively can lead to healthier eating habits and better overall well-being. By understanding the roots of your cravings and implementing strategic management techniques, you can regain control over your food choices and enjoy a more balanced lifestyle.
